NovaBay Pharmaceuticals, Inc. reported significant financial changes in its latest 10-Q filing for the quarter ending June 30, 2025. The company recorded a net loss of $1.9 million, compared to a net loss of $1.6 million in the same period last year. The increase in loss was attributed to higher general and administrative expenses, which rose by 17% to $1.9 million, primarily due to costs associated with strategic initiatives following the divestiture of its eyecare and skincare businesses. The company’s total operating expenses for the quarter were $1.9 million, up from $1.6 million in the prior year.
In terms of liquidity, NovaBay's cash and cash equivalents increased significantly to $5.3 million as of June 30, 2025, compared to $430,000 at the end of 2024. This increase was largely due to proceeds from the divestiture of its Avenova and PhaseOne assets, which generated approximately $10.5 million and $0.5 million, respectively. The company also reported a total asset value of $6.9 million, up from $3.4 million at the end of the previous fiscal year, reflecting the cash influx from these transactions.
Strategically, NovaBay has undergone substantial restructuring, having divested its primary business segments, including the Avenova eyecare brand and the PhaseOne wound care trademarks. The Avenova Asset Divestiture was completed on January 17, 2025, for a base purchase price of $11.5 million, while the PhaseOne Divestiture occurred shortly thereafter on January 8, 2025, for $500,000. These divestitures have led to a significant reduction in the company's operational scope, with future revenue expected to primarily come from the manufacture of wound care products.
The company is currently evaluating its strategic options, including a potential voluntary dissolution, which was approved by stockholders in April 2025. However, the board retains discretion on whether to proceed with this plan or explore alternative strategic transactions. NovaBay's management believes that its existing cash reserves will be sufficient to cover operational expenses through at least August 2026, although uncertainties regarding future claims and liabilities remain.

About 10-Q Filings
A 10-Q form is an important financial report that public companies in the United States must submit every three months. It gives a clear picture of a company's financial health and recent performance.
Key points about the 10-Q:
- Frequency: Companies file it three times a year, covering the first three quarters. The fourth quarter is covered in a more comprehensive annual report.
-
Content: It includes:
- Financial statements showing the company's current financial position
- Updates from management on the performance and projections of the business
- Information about potential risks the company faces
- Details on how the company is run internally
- Deadline: Must be filed within 40 or 45 days after the quarter ends, depending on the size of the company.
